"I..." Nanrong Wanqing’s pretty face blushed slightly as she shook her head, "I’ve never dated, so it’s useless to ask me."

"Chairwoman, you are a golden flower of East Sea City; I bet the line of men chasing after you could circle around East Sea City. Are you saying not one of these men caught your eye?"

"What they pursue is not me as a person, but the wealth of the Nanrong Family. After all, I am not a complete person." She said with a faint smile, revealing a sense of desolation, "Besides, I’m not interested in this sort of thing right now. The Nanrong Family needs someone to take charge, and I can’t be distracted. Perhaps when Nanrong Hao grows up, I might consider it."

Ling Chen looked at her stunned, not expecting this woman to be so indifferent about her own disability. To avoid making her sad, he went along with her, "Haozi is lucky to have such a good sister like you. It’s a pity that he doesn’t understand much now and can’t feel the sacrifices and efforts you’ve made for him."

"That’s why I need your help, to help him change."

"There’s no rush. Take it one step at a time, the food should be eaten bite by bite, the road should be walked step by step. Haozi has a good nature, I believe he won’t disappoint you." After saying that, he stood up, patting the leaves off his behind, "It’s been a whole night, you must be hungry, I’ll find you something to eat."

After busying himself for half an hour, Ling Chen managed to find some wild vegetables and mushrooms.

He returned to Nanrong Wanqing’s side, tossed the food he gathered on the ground, and then walked toward the damaged Mercedes-Benz van, rummaging through it.

Before long, he found a few bottles of mineral water and some simple tools. Right there and then, he improvised a stove using parts from the car, set it up on a wood fire, with flames rising underneath.

Once the stove was red-hot, he poured mineral water inside, then added mushrooms and wild vegetables to make a soup.

Although there were no seasonings like oil, salt, soy sauce, or vinegar, these wild vegetables had a good natural taste. He tasted it, then brought the pot over to Nanrong Wanqing.

"Aren’t you eating?" Nanrong Wanqing asked, seeing him sitting on the side watching her.

"I’ve eaten already." Ling Chen said. His wilderness survival skills were far superior to Nanrong Wanqing’s. There were many things in the woods he could eat raw; if it wasn’t for taking care of Nanrong Wanqing, he wouldn’t have needed to put in so much effort.

Probably starving, Nanrong Wanqing devoured the mushrooms and wild vegetables until the pot was clean.

"How is it? It should taste no worse than the egg noodle soup." Ling Chen said with a smile.

Hearing him mention the egg noodle soup caused a hint of embarrassment in Nanrong Wanqing’s beautiful eyes.

"Thank you."

"No need to be polite. You sit tight; I’ll go clean up."

Ling Chen was about to get up when suddenly, a raindrop fell on his head. He looked up to see the sky had turned; what had been sunny now was overcast with a sudden change of face.

Before he could usher Nanrong Wanqing into the car, a torrential downpour started, falling heavily on the leaves and instantly soaking their clothes.

Ling Chen hurriedly picked up Nanrong Wanqing and took her into the van.

Watching the intensity of the rain grow, he frowned to himself, thinking this was trouble.

...

Meanwhile, on a rural road, two police cars were parked at the roadside, with Xia Mutong standing in front of the wrecked muscle car, holding an umbrella and looking anxiously across the fields.

"Tang Yuan, are you sure they went that way?"

"There are tire tracks in the field over there, definitely can’t be wrong."

Last night, when Ling Chen became unreachable, Tang Yuan immediately tracked his cellphone signal and hurried here, only to find the car and the abandoned cellphone inside, but no sign of Ling Chen himself.

Because it was night at that time and the surroundings were shrouded in darkness with weeds overgrown in the fields, it was inconvenient to search, so they had to wait for daylight to begin the search operation.

Szzz... At this moment, an electric crackle came from the walkie-talkie on Xia Mutong’s body, followed by a report: "Captain Xia, the rain is too heavy, the tire tracks on the fields are almost washed away."

"As long as we’re heading in the right direction that’s fine. I will request higher authorities for additional support and expand the search area."

After speaking, Xia Mutong turned to look at Tang Yuan, "You should go back first, we will do our best to locate Miss Nanrong and Ling Chen."

Tang Yuan shook his head, pulled out his cellphone, and stepped aside to dial a number.

After hanging up, Tang Yuan returned to Xia Mutong’s side and said earnestly, "Officer Xia, from now on, I am in full charge of the search and rescue for Miss Nanrong and Ling Chen, the East Sea City police force will cooperate with my actions unconditionally."

"You..."

"You don’t need to ask more, I think you will soon receive a call from your superiors."

As soon as Tang Yuan finished speaking, Xia Mutong’s phone rang. She looked at Tang Yuan with surprise and skepticism and took out her cellphone. When she saw the name on the incoming call display, her expression changed.

"Who are you?" After listening to the call, Xia Mutong asked with a face full of astonishment. She thought Tang Yuan was just a security staff member of the Nanrong family, but it didn’t seem to be the case. Could a security person make the bureau chief personally call her?

"Officer Xia, you don’t need to know too much, what’s most important now is to find their whereabouts," Tang Yuan said as he spread out a map and drew a circle on it with a pen, "Based on my judgment, they should be within this area."

"This area is almost thirty to forty kilometers, our manpower is limited, we can’t complete the search of this area in a short time."

"Call all the support you have, and have helicopters search the area non-stop, 24 hours a day. Ling Chen is smart, he should know we are looking for him and will definitely find a way to contact us."

...

More than two hours passed, and the rain showed no sign of abating.

Inside the woods, the torrential rain was accompanied by gusts of wind that blew through the trees, bringing a hint of autumn coolness and the fresh scent of the earth.

Inside the Mercedes-Benz van, Ling Chen and Nanrong Wanqing sat in the back seat, quietly waiting for the rain to stop.

At that moment, a cool breeze blew into the van, and Nanrong Wanqing, who was thinly clad, couldn’t help but yawn. Having been soaked by the rain and then chilled by the cold wind, Nanrong Wanqing’s already delicate body was struggling to hold up.

Ling Chen felt helpless; the windows of the van had been smashed and could not be closed.

Seeing Nanrong Wanqing hugging her arms, drenched and curled up inside the vehicle, her lips turning pale, Ling Chen couldn’t help but feel compassion. If this continued, Nanrong Wanqing was bound to fall ill sooner or later.

Unfortunately, there was nothing in the van to keep them warm, and his own clothes were soaked through.

"Chairwoman, how are you feeling, are you alright?"

"I’m fine, don’t worry about me." As soon as she spoke the words, bursts of cold wind poured into the van, causing Nanrong Wanqing to tremble involuntarily.

Seeing her in this state, Ling Chen felt distressed but didn’t know what to do.

"Chairwoman..."

"Hmm?"

"Talk to me." Ling Chen wanted to divert her attention and lift her spirits by conversing with her.
